So our book, Dear White Women: Let's Get (Un)comfortable Talking About Racism is broken into three sections: On Being White in America; On Being Black in America; On Being a Non-Black Person of Color in America.
And here's the question we get when people see that structure: Why do we need to focus on the experiences of Black people in this country?
In this episode, we tell you why - including sharing some things we all need to (re)learn, since it's not all taught in our schools.
